The newly built residential project “Haus Gables” in Atlanta, Georgia, impresses with 204 m² of living space and an innovative cross-laminated timber structure. It is the second building of its kind in the USA and features a sustainable structure made of glued, cross-layered timber. Bensonwood created the 3D model in RFEM.
Designed by Jennifer Bonner, an architect and the CEO of MALL, the building shows the trend towards modern structural timber solutions. Completed in the Old Fourth Ward, it combines traditional materials with forward-looking design.
